The book Assignment in Eternity, first published in 1953, comprises a collection of science fiction novellas by Robert A. Heinlein.
It contains "Gulf", "Elsewhen", "Lost Legacy", and "Jerry Was a Man". Three of these ("Gulf", "Lost Legacy", and "Jerry Was a Man") contain speculation on what makes one a human, and the first two of those depict potential for evolution into a superior form of human.
The Baen Books paperback 1987 edition reprints Heinlein's future history chart, even though none of the four stories appear on the chart.
Heinlein dedicated the book "To Sprague and Catherine": L. Sprague de Camp (his friend and noted science fiction author) and his wife Catherine Crook de Camp.
